How to Qualify

What you need to qualify for Invoice Factoring

6+ months in business

Established operating history with verifiable revenue.

$10K+ monthly revenue

Consistent deposits across the last 3–6 statements.

550+ FICO score

Soft pull only — your score is not impacted at intake.

US-based business

Registered entity with valid EIN and California licensing where required.

Active business bank account

We review 3–6 months of statements to verify cash flow health.
